Plan Based on Project Timeline

Project duration plays a major role in container choice. Short-term projects may require a smaller container that can be filled and removed quickly, while ongoing projects might benefit from a larger container that can accommodate continuous waste generation. Aligning rental duration with project timing ensures smooth operations and prevents overflow. Coordinating rental periods ensures timely pickup and a hazard-free environment. Considering project length early promotes organized and effective disposal.

Load Your Dumpster for Maximum Efficiency

The way debris is loaded determines both capacity usage and transport safety. Placing heavier and larger items on the bottom creates a stable base, while filling gaps with smaller materials maximizes capacity. Breaking down boxes, dismantling furniture, and flattening bulky items helps fit more into the container and prevents uneven loads. Efficient loading also reduces the risk of debris spilling or shifting during pickup. Thoughtful loading ensures safety and maintains a tidy worksite.
